Seed Germination Course of
The Bermuda grass seed germination course of begins with the preliminary imbibition of water. This course of softens the seed coat, enabling the embryo to soak up water and provoke metabolic actions. The radicle, the primary root construction to emerge, pushes by the seed coat, anchoring the seedling and enabling water and nutrient absorption. Subsequently, the plumule, the embryonic shoot, develops, and the cotyledons, seed leaves, emerge, offering preliminary nourishment.
Bermuda grass seed germination usually takes 7-14 days, relying on soil circumstances and temperature. Optimizing Soil Circumstances for Sooner Progress
Optimizing soil circumstances is important for selling quicker development and bigger measurement in Bermuda grass. Effectively-drained, fertile soil wealthy in natural matter is essential for wholesome root improvement and nutrient absorption. Sustaining correct soil pH ranges, usually inside a variety of 6.0 to 7.0, ensures optimum nutrient availability. Amendments like compost or different natural matter can enhance soil construction and drainage, finally contributing to quicker and extra strong development.
